Lebanon, VA 24266
Displaying Physician 37 - 45 of 129 in total

Dr. Anne Dibala MD
-
71 S Flannagan Ave
Lebanon, VA, 24266 - (276) 883-8042

Mary Ernst APRN, BC
-
71 S Flannagan Ave
Lebanon, VA, 24266 - (276) 883-8042

Dr. Shenia Johnson DNP FNP-BC, PMHNP-BC
-
71 S Flannagan Ave
Lebanon, VA, 24266 - (276) 883-8030

Dr. Edgar Kahn MD
-
71 S Flannagan Ave
Lebanon, VA, 24266 - (276) 883-8042

Mary Olmsted MD
-
71 S Flannagan Ave
Lebanon, VA, 24266 - (276) 883-8042

Juan Rodriguez MD
-
71 S Flannagan Ave
Lebanon, VA, 24266 - (276) 883-8042

Dr. Joseph Farmer PHARMD
-
116 Flanagan Ave
Lebanon, VA, 24266 - (276) 889-5721

Crystal Perkins PHARMD
-
116 Flanagan Ave
Lebanon, VA, 24266 - (276) 889-5721

Steffey Powers PHARMACIST
-
116 Flanagan Ave
Lebanon, VA, 24266 - (276) 889-5721